Summary

Cisco IOS XE 3.10.2S on an ASR 1000 device with an Embedded Services Processor (ESP) module, when NAT is enabled, allows remote attackers to cause a denial of service (module crash) via malformed H.323 packets, aka Bug ID CSCup21070.

descriptionCisco IOS XE Software for 1000 Series Aggregation Services Routers (ASR) is affected by a flaw in the Embedded Services Processor (ESP) due to improper handling of malformed H.323 packets when the device is configured to use Network Address Translation (NAT). An unauthenticated, remote attacker by sending malformed H.323 packets, can exploit this vulnerability to cause a denial of service by crashing the ESP module.
